    A while back, I turned on the debug menu. Now, despite unchecking and saving repeatedly, the debug box remains checked and debug outputs show up in various sections of the admin site.

    I thought perhaps it was a caching issue but I don’t believe my wp-admin section is cached.

    Also thought perhaps it was due to a DB issues but optimize/repair hasn’t made the setting stick.

    Any thoughts? Is there something within mySQL I could just edit to turn off debug?

    You could, but the most likely cause is your webhost’s object caching, which caches database queries. So it is likely the database has already updated, but their object cache is making the plugin think it should still be in debug mode. You can likely just ignore it and check back in a few hours (or check with your webhost to see if there is a way to flush that).
